You can now play any adhoc enabled PSP game over the internet with Adhoc Party– if you have a PS3, and have it connected to the internet over ethernet. While this isn’t ideal, it is better than nothing. Square/Enix has announced that Final Fantasy will be coming to the West on March 9th, 2010.
